REPORTS TO: Director of Distribution & Educational Programming
SALARY: $22/hour
STATUS: Part-time Contract (non-exempt)
WORK SCHEDULE 15-22.5 hours/week with flexibility and expanded hours during peak periods.
NATURE OF THE POSITION
The Digital Media Coordinator will be responsible for the creation, delivery, and organization of both physical and electronic film resources for Frameline Distribution, Frameline Voices, and Youth in Motion, with additional work during peak Festival season as well. This position will assist in preparing design items including advertisements, curriculum, and postcards as they relate to the Distribution Department. The ideal candidate should be familiar with film/video distribution and formats and dedicated to meeting deadlines within a calendar of deliverables already established.
REQUIRED SKILLS & EXPERIENCE
• Proficiency in Adobe Premiere as well as Compressor and DVD Studio Pro to capture films from, and output to, various digital and analog formats.
• Experience with online digital delivery to platforms, including handling of metadata, and utilizing FTP sites, Dropbox, and other delivery systems.
• 1-3 years of working in media-arts related field
• Strong communication skills, both verbal and written
• Ability to work independently, as well as part of a team
• Effective time management, particularly with changing work schedule
• Familiarity with Macintosh systems, including Word, Excel, and FileMaker
DESIRED SKILLS & EXPERIENCE
•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ience in film production or related field
• Experience preparing digital files for platforms such as Vimeo and Amazon
• Experience using Adobe Creative Design Suite (Photoshop and InDesign) to create artwork, including DVD jackets and labels
• Experience editing film trailers and DVD extras
• Familiarity with LGBTQ media, issues and/or community
RESPONSIBLITIES
Frameline Distribution - Digital Delivery, Reformatting, and DVD Creation (80% of the time)
• Format all films to be ready for delivery to online streaming platforms.
• Adjust aspect ratio, codec, and generally convert video files for digital platforms, often from analog/SD source material.
• Build DVDs and create DVD artwork, advertisements, and other items as required.
• Assist in creating clips/trailers for new releases and Frameline Distribution related programs: Frameline Voices, Youth in Motion, and Frameline Distribution
• Maintain online communications for Frameline's Vimeo and YouTube accounts
• Assist with social media and website updates as needed
• Other duties, including administrative duties, as assigned Frameline Festival Digital Materials Coordinating (20% of the time)
